German Channel is a renowned dive site located in Koror, Palau, famous for its rich marine biodiversity and vibrant coral reefs. The channel serves as a natural passage for marine life, making it an excellent location for divers to observe a variety of species.
Diving in German Channel typically involves exploring the channel's walls and the surrounding coral gardens. Divers can expect to see large schools of fish, manta rays, and occasionally sharks. The dive can include both shallow and deeper sections, providing a diverse experience.
